Sankara SampradhAyam
Prof. Hajme Nakamura had asked the same question to HH MahA SwAmy of Kanchi when had
come to have His dharshan - "When the bhAshyams of AchAryAl talk about advaitham, how
is that His successor (i.e. PeriyavA) is wearing vibbhuthi (basmam) and doing Chandra
moulIswara pUja in the math daily ?"
SrI PeriyavAl's lucid and deep answer to this and also on the smArtha sampradhAyam and as
to why it is generally asscociated with saivaite tradition, albeit wrongly, is worth
reading:
"Sankara sampra dhAyam", Deivathin Kural (in Tamil), Vol II, pp: 119-157, Second
Edition (1980).
